Transaction 5d1a63bda319eae68dbe40327de19381429351eec12d6cbf7d5041a37d54240a
1 Input
2 Outputs
- 5d1a63bda319eae68dbe40327de19381429351eec12d6cbf7d5041a37d54240a:0
- 5d1a63bda319eae68dbe40327de19381429351eec12d6cbf7d5041a37d54240a:1
value 8125000
address mpMPqhqjzDajuBFDn7kgN97NX4eZYhUMPy
value 473473325184
address mnPtM4EDs1LUNnm7LddhUkMyWnTV3thjxu